Transaction 453ec2378b50b1d68a490ab30feb60cd68b0d55deb955623aa1d132088b86ab0
1 Input
1 Output
-
453ec2378b50b1d68a490ab30feb60cd68b0d55deb955623aa1d132088b86ab0:0
- value
- 41848300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 588c911bd69274af495dd0550206a2a9782c84e0 OP_EQUAL
- address
- 39mDnBN12jDjiFYBszW5DG11tGeZxFWD6C